Description

Ex. Mins, Nos. 26 and 27.
Creation of New Positions.- Director, Division of Public Health Engineering, Third Division, with limits of salary of minimum £900, and maximum of £1,000 per annum.
Appointment. - Alan Gordon Gutteridge, who is not an officer of the Commonwealth Service, appointed on probation, without examination, as Director, Third Division, Division of Public Health Engineering, with salary of £900 per annum, appointment to take effect from date of commencing duty.
